Which outcome occurs when high-intensity laser pulses experience self-phase modulation while propagating through a non-linear medium?

A)Broader optical frequency spectrum emerges
B)Consistent pulse energy is maintained
C)Spatial beam profile remains unchanged
D)Refractive index becomes homogeneous

💡 Explanation

A broader optical frequency spectrum emerges because the laser's intensity-dependent refractive index changes cause a time-dependent phase shift, thus generating new frequencies via self-phase modulation. Therefore, spectral broadening occurs rather than constant pulse energy without frequency changes.
